22nd season in New England. 17 AFC East Division titles. Nine AFC Championships. Six Super Bowl trophies. Sure, there was a generational quarterback leading the way on the field, and many other outstanding athletes “doing their jobs.”
But haven’t you always thought, “In Bill We Trust?” And don’t you still?
Last year’s 7-9 hiccup can almost be washed away with a dismissive “it was a Covid season” rationale. After a year of retooling, rebuilding, and re-creating, Belichick has the Patriots right back where fans argue they belong and many have come to expect.
Like he has in his past. In first place within the AFC.
And the rest of the NFL now must deal with it.
In a career where there have been some incredible opportunities, great game plans in place with JAG’s, Joe’s and star athletes performing side-by-side, Bill Belichick had perhaps the most unusual happenstance of his tenure occur Monday night in Buffalo.
His quarterback threw three passes, completing two. His running game ran the ball 46 times, the most in nearly three full seasons, and began the game with 10 straight rushing plays before ever considering a pass into the swirling Buffalo breeze.
It was also the 7th time in his Patriots career his team ran for more than 200 yards on the ground.
And his defense continues to respond to multiple challenges in soul-crushing fashion, allowing a mere field goal to the Bills Monday night in the second half – the only second half points scored against New England over the past five weeks.
It was weird. It was hand-wringing, teeth-grinding, yell-out-at-the-TV stuff Monday night. The Patriots threw the least number of passes in a game in franchise history and the fewest attempts in an NFL game since 1974. Throw the damn ball!
But we weren’t there, in the elements. He was, with Josh McDaniels making the calls, and the plan was brilliant in its simplicity.
“We kind of played the way we felt we needed to win,” Belichick told the media postgame.
And still, you doubt? There have been missteps along the way, of course. Opponents have figured him out (but not often), players who haven’t performed to expectation (his, or our own) and draft decisions that have left us all scratching our heads.
But make no mistake here – the Patriots are now back in the mix. The NFL’s ultimate good guys/bad guys, depending upon your point of view. And it’s due in large part to Belichick just being Bill, doing Bill things like he’s always done.
You remember those, right? Monday night was just another in a long line of ’em. Trust that there will be more to come.

Three things happen…
The old coaching adage of “three things happen when you throw the ball and two of them are bad” played out to near perfection. It’s an old-school, running game philosophy dating to the ’60s and beyond, long ago lost in the whirlwind of shotgun formations and five-wide receivers.
But it’s easy to second guess. Wouldn’t a play-action pass have worked, with all those runs setting it up? Especially on 3rd down conversion opportunities? They were just 2-for-12 converting those chances against Buffalo’s defense.
Hindsight is 20-20, of course. And hindsight here says the Patriots won the game playing it the way they did, so…
Flags on the field
Six penalties for 47 yards may or may not sound like a big deal to you. And in the end, it wasn’t big for the Patriots to deal with.
But a killer holding call going against Jonnu Smith in the 3rd quarter – a questionable call at best – snuffed a potential scoring drive right out of existence. And a horrible call made on Myles Bryant for unnecessary roughness later in the period handed the Bills three points on a silver platter.
It was windy on that platter, to be sure. But in a tight game where scoring chances are at a minimum, mistakes get magnified.
What in the world?
N’Keal Harry‘s role has been relegated to primarily one of blocking, with few pass attempts (when there ARE pass attempts) coming his way of late. And he has certainly been a primary reason for the improvements in the running game overall – he’s tough for smaller defensive backs to handle when it comes to clearing the way.
But his muffed punt return in the 1st quarter that directly led to the Bills’ only touchdown? The way the ball was bouncing, it’s hard to place all of the blame on his, um, helmet. But the decision to put him back there to receive a kick, when he had yet to do that as a pro…and with an all-pro caliber returner in Gunner Olszewski?
I mean, really, guys? What are we thinking here? Perhaps, on occasion, even the best can overthink a call or two.
